Georgia's business landscape spans everything from logistics hubs at the Port of Savannah to fintech operations in Atlanta's thriving downtown corridor, and AI adoption is accelerating across all these sectors. The state's combination of established Fortune 500 companies, rapid startup growth, and a strong talent pipeline from Georgia Tech, Emory, and UGA means demand for AI expertise far outpaces supply. Whether you're optimizing supply chains, automating customer service, or building predictive models, finding an AI professional who understands Georgia's specific industries and regulatory environment makes a measurable difference.
Georgia hosts one of the fastest-growing tech ecosystems in the Southeast, with Atlanta emerging as a genuine AI hub outside California and New York. Google, Meta, IBM, and Delta Air Lines have all expanded engineering and AI teams in the state, creating both competition for talent and proof points that serious AI work happens here. Georgia Tech's College of Computing pumps out machine learning specialists, data scientists, and software engineers annually, though most companies still struggle to fill roles quickly enough. The state government itself has invested in AI initiatives through initiatives like the Georgia Innovation & Entrepreneurship Commission, signaling commitment to building infrastructure beyond traditional corporate players. Startup activity has intensified dramatically since 2020. Venture capital flowing into Georgia-based AI startups reached significant levels through firms like Flashpoint Venture Capital and local angel networks. Companies like Kabbage (now Amex) and Cash App competitor Square have shown that Atlanta can birth and scale fintech businesses successfully. The talent density in Midtown Atlanta and the emerging Westside tech corridor means cross-pollination between corporate AI teams and startup founders happens organically, unlike markets where these worlds remain siloed.
The Port of Savannah moved over 5.5 million twenty-foot equivalent units in 2022, making it the fourth busiest container port in North America. Terminal operators, logistics companies, and freight forwarders throughout Georgia now deploy machine learning for container tracking, predictive maintenance on equipment, and dynamic route optimization. When a shipper loses a day to equipment failure or a dispatcher manually routes trucks inefficiently, AI solutions directly hit the bottom line. This creates steady demand for professionals with supply chain domain knowledge plus ML capabilities. Delta Air Lines' substantial Atlanta headquarters and maintenance operations represent another major AI user. Predictive maintenance on aircraft engines, crew scheduling optimization, dynamic pricing algorithms, and customer service chatbots all run on AI systems. The airline industry's razor-thin margins mean even small efficiency gains justify investment. Other major employers like UPS (significant Georgia operations), Agero, and regional healthcare networks depend heavily on AI for customer support automation and operational optimization. Financial services and fintech companies cluster heavily in Atlanta. From traditional banking operations at SunTrust (now Truist) to emerging payment processors and investment platforms, machine learning powers fraud detection, credit underwriting, and algorithmic trading. Healthcare providers including Emory Healthcare and Grady Memorial Hospital increasingly deploy AI for diagnostic imaging analysis, patient outcome prediction, and administrative automation. Unlike Silicon Valley's consumer-focused AI, much of Georgia's AI work directly impacts operational efficiency in industries with substantial real-world stakes.
Georgia's AI consultant landscape includes generalists from boutique firms, specialists embedded at larger consulting companies like Deloitte's Atlanta office, and independent contractors who've built expertise within Georgia-based industries. The best fit depends on your project scope and timeline. Need to overhaul your logistics optimization strategy across multiple facilities? A consultant with prior port or supply chain experience cuts months off your discovery phase. Building your first machine learning model for fraud detection? Someone with banking experience understands regulatory constraints that generalists often overlook. When vetting AI professionals in Georgia, check whether they've actually worked with your industry segment. A consultant who optimized warehouse operations might not be your best choice for healthcare compliance-heavy imaging analysis. Georgia Tech affiliation matters less than you'd think—some of the sharpest practitioners learned on the job at Delta, UPS, or regional health systems. Ask specifically about their experience with your data infrastructure (cloud platforms, data warehouses, legacy systems) and whether they understand Georgia's relatively permissive but increasingly active regulatory environment around algorithmic transparency and bias auditing. Timing and budget alignment differ wildly between Georgia's corporate headquarters (where six-figure budgets for AI pilots are standard) and mid-market manufacturers or regional retailers (where lean budgets require efficiency-focused consultants). The best local professionals often work flexibly across these tiers, scaling scope based on your constraints rather than imposing rigid engagement models.
Georgia companies are heavily focused on operational efficiency and cost reduction rather than moonshot projects. Supply chain optimization dominates—especially among Port of Savannah users and logistics operators. Customer service automation through chatbots and intelligent routing is widespread across healthcare and financial services. Predictive maintenance for equipment-heavy industries like manufacturing, airlines, and transportation generates substantial ROI. Healthcare systems increasingly fund diagnostic imaging AI and patient risk stratification. What you don't see much of in Georgia: consumer-facing AI products, autonomous vehicles, or cutting-edge research projects. The capital-efficient, back-office automation focus makes sense given the state's industrial composition.
Georgia attracts talented AI professionals because salaries are significantly lower than Bay Area equivalents (typically 20-30% less) while cost of living in desirable Atlanta neighborhoods remains reasonable. This creates attractive economics for senior engineers and consultants. However, Georgia doesn't yet match coastal hubs for venture capital density, exit liquidity, or the sheer critical mass of AI startups competing for attention. Atlanta-based AI founders often raise Series A funding, then watch investors suggest relocating to San Francisco. The talent pipeline from Georgia Tech is phenomenal, but many graduates migrate to coastal companies post-graduation. For AI professionals seeking predictable corporate work or specialized consulting, Georgia is excellent. For those chasing rapid scaling or cutting-edge research environments, coastal hubs still win.
Georgia hasn't implemented state-specific AI regulation, which differs from California's AI bias audit requirements or Colorado's algorithmic transparency laws. This creates operational flexibility for companies developing AI systems. However, Georgia-based companies serving national or international markets still must comply with federal frameworks, GDPR if serving EU customers, and industry-specific regulations (healthcare HIPAA, finance GLBA). Port of Savannah operations must align with maritime regulations. The regulatory environment is more permissive than coastal states, but not meaningfully more advantageous unless your business model specifically requires avoiding transparency or bias audit requirements. For most organizations, this neutrality is preferable to navigating fragmented state regulations.
Georgia Tech dominates the quantity and brand recognition, but Emory University has strengthened its computer science and machine learning programs substantially, particularly for healthcare AI applications. The University of Georgia's engineering school produces competent developers, though typically not specialists. Many Georgia-based companies recruit from schools where Georgia Tech wasn't an option, recognizing that practical experience matters far more than pedigree. Several coding bootcamps in Atlanta (General Assembly, DataCamp) produce bootcamp graduates who find work quickly in junior roles. The reality: Georgia Tech is the obvious first source for experienced hires, but the talent market has enough depth that non-Tech graduates don't face employment barriers if their portfolios are strong.
Rates vary dramatically by expertise level and project type. Junior AI consultants or freelancers charging $75-150 per hour handle straightforward implementation work. Mid-level consultants with 5-10 years experience and specific domain expertise (supply chain, healthcare, finance) typically charge $200-400 per hour. Senior consultants or small firms with proven track records in Georgia industries bill $300-600+ per hour or work on project basis ranging $30K-150K depending on scope. Strategy engagements with major consulting firms (Deloitte, Accenture, McKinsey) start at $50K-100K+ for initial assessments. Many Georgia AI professionals offer hybrid models: reduced hourly rates for longer commitments, or shared-risk pricing where compensation ties to measurable ROI. Budget $15K-50K minimum for any meaningful project; expect $100K+ if you need production implementation or multi-month engagement.
